Antonio,
What we must use to replace our .RC files.
Does exists a software like Resource Workshop to design our forms?
Regards!
Maurilio
Maurilio,
>
What we must use to replace our .RC files.
Does exists a software like Resource Workshop to design our forms?
>
Mac OSX provides an "Interface Builder", included for free with Mac OSX, where you can visually design the user interface. It creates "NIB" files ("Next Interface Builder") that will be accessed from the application.
For FoxPro users, we are going to provide support for DO FORM <form.scx> command.

Osvaldo,
> Will there two way to desings form's ?
> I mean, via VFP and Interface Builder ?
Yes, we want that FoxPro users may be able to reuse their existing Windows forms with FiveMac.
Our plan is to provide a form designer built-in with FiveMac, that will allow to modify existing forms and create new ones.
Interface Builder creates NIB files (XML format) that may be also used from FiveMac.
>
If VFP form, could be loaded from prg ... All the object propierties will accesed from prg level ?
>
Yes, a true object is created using and providing the same properties.
>
Tell us the price and Dates for testing FiveMac, I would like to get some things like FWPCC, ... until a stable release.
>
A pre-release may be available for early january 2007. Price 290 euros, internet delivery.
